Shot on 8mm film in 1958, this vintage home movie captures a powerful geyser eruption at Yellowstone National Park. The iconic spout of water and steam shoots high into the overcast sky, framed by dark forest silhouettes. The footage exhibits classic Super 8 grain, slight color fading, and natural film imperfections, offering authentic archival footage of a natural wonder. This nostalgic clip evokes mid-century Americana and the timeless beauty of Yellowstone's geothermal activity.
